    XP-360 Horsepower chart

    Anyone have a calibration chart for an XP-360? The graph that came with my manual seems to leave a bit to be desired. When I use it, I only come up with four data points that have both 55% and 75% power. Also, I can't figure out how to get the HP Delta.

    This is what I get. The left numbers are 55% and the right numbers are 75%...

    2000 21.9
    2100 21.4
    2200 20.8
    2300 20.3 25.5
    2400 19.9 24.8
    2500 19.4 24.2
    2600 19.1 23.7
    2700 xx.x 23.4

    Hello, the HP delta is explained below. You will have to get the data from your engine manufacturer.

    The following data is supplied only as a reference; you should use your Lycoming engine graphs to verify
    the accuracy of the display. The Delta HP number is the increase in actual HP that the engine will
    produce for the same manifold and RPM at increased Altitude.
